No power Interruptions as tariffs increased…

As of today (Feb. 16), when the new power tariff revision goes into effect, an uninterrupted power supply will be offered, according to Minister of Power and Energy Kanchana Wijesekera.

Minister Wijesekera added that the President has also ordered him to provide the people with an uninterrupted power supply during a special news conference he held this morning addressing the revision of the electricity rate.

In addition, he claimed that the Bank of Ceylon (BOC) had consented to extend a further loan of Rs. 22 billion for the purchase of coal in exchange for the adjustment of the electricity tariff’s approval.The new electricity pricing revision will therefore go into effect starting today (Feb. 16), according to the Minister.

“It would have been simpler for us if the idea we presented in January had been enacted in January. In spite of any delay, I believe we can guarantee an uninterrupted power supply starting today.

The Minister emphasized that this new system has only been proposed to cover the cost of generating electricity from today after pointing out that several people had attempted to spread rumors that the tariff revision is done in order to cover the previous losses of the Ceylon Electricity Board (CEB).
